1. The Backbone of Protection: Choosing the Ideal Sheet Metal
The integrity of any Industrial Machine Enclosure starts with the material. We don’t compromise, selecting specific grades of sheet metal best suited for the demanding environment of industrial machinery:
The Industrial Workhorse: Q235 Carbon Steel (A3 Grade): For a vast range of Industrial Machine Enclosures, Q235 is an outstanding choice. This carbon structural steel brings a fantastic combination of strength, good plasticity (making it formable for complex designs), and excellent weldability. We rely on its typical yield strength of around – a figure that ensures it can handle significant loads and vibrations. With a controlled hardness of and availability in thicknesses from all the way up to , it provides the robust framework necessary to support and protect your machinery. It’s the go-to for a reason.
For Specialized Environments: Premium 304 Stainless Steel: When your machinery operates in environments with corrosive substances, frequent wash-downs, or stringent hygiene requirements (like food processing or pharmaceuticals), our 304 Stainless Steel Industrial Machine Enclosures are the solution. This material is prized for its excellent corrosion resistance and is inherently non-magnetic. Its impressive hardness of and availability in a similar thickness range ( to ) mean it doesn't sacrifice toughness for its protective qualities.
Versatile & Stable: Electro-galvanized Steel (SECC): SECC often finds its place in constructing internal components, support brackets, or enclosures for less mechanically aggressive machinery. Its electro-galvanized surface is uniform, oil-free, and provides good base stability with a hardness of . We typically use it in thicknesses like up to where appropriate for specific parts of an Industrial Machine Enclosure.
2. Design Intelligence: Beyond a Simple Box for Your Machinery
An effective Industrial Machine Enclosure is engineered with the entire operational lifecycle in mind. We focus on:
Operator Safety First: Designs incorporate features to protect personnel from moving parts, electrical hazards, and other operational risks. This is a non-negotiable aspect of our sheet metal constructions.
Structural Integrity & Vibration Management: Machinery can be heavy and generate vibrations. Our enclosures are designed with the necessary rigidity, using appropriate sheet metal thicknesses (like the robust or Q235) and structural reinforcements to provide stable housing and potentially dampen vibrations.
Accessibility for Maintenance: We know downtime is costly. Our Industrial Machine Enclosures are designed with strategically placed access panels, doors, and removable sections to allow for easier inspection, maintenance, and repair of the enclosed machinery.
Integration with Control Systems: Enclosures are often designed to seamlessly incorporate control panels, HMIs, and cable management systems, ensuring a clean and functional setup.
Process-Specific Considerations: Whether it's managing heat dissipation – The design of heat dissipation holes must balance protection level and ventilation efficiency), containing process by-products, or meeting specific industry standards, our sheet metal designs are adaptable.

Q4: What material options do you recommend for a factory floor with occasional spills or coolant exposure?For general factory conditions with a risk of non-corrosive fluid exposure, our Q235 carbon steel Industrial Machine Enclosures, properly treated with a durable powder coat finish, offer excellent protection. If the exposure involves more aggressive chemicals or requires frequent, intensive cleaning, then an enclosure made from 304 Stainless Steel, with its inherent hardness and superior corrosion resistance, would be the more robust long-term choice.
